So this morning I tried to process an order a customer had sent me last night.  I went to log into my photolab service provider, exposuremanager.com, just like I always do.  Bzzzt.  Can't get in.  "This link appears to be broken."

Huh, maybe it's my machine.  So I try my daughter's machine, nope she can't see it either.  Internet down?  Nope I can get my email and see all the other sites I use regularly.

So I (reasonably) assume exposuremanager is down.  That's not too cool--because while it is down my customers can't place orders.  So I call customer support and leave them a message that their site is down.

A little while later I get an e-mail from them stating their site is up and running fine (and by the way, nice pictures on your site!) Thanks, but I still can't get in.

So I try the DOS utility "ping" to ping their server.  Sometimes it can't resolve exposuremanager to an IP address (implying a problem with a domain name server at Comcast) and other times it can resolve the IP address but gets no response.  I check with WHOIS on Tucows (their registrar) to see if their domain has expired, but it hasn't.  WTF?

So then I run a traceroute in an attempt to see where the communication fails between me and exposuremanager:

Tracing route to exposuremanager.com [66.254.91.235]

over a maximum of 30 hops:

 

  1    <1 ms    <1 ms    <1 ms  www.routerlogin.com [192.168.1.1]

  2     7 ms    10 ms     7 ms  [ my IP omitted ]

  3     8 ms     8 ms     6 ms  ge-1-2-ur01.gardner.ma.boston.comcast.net [68.85.187.109]

  4    11 ms    10 ms     9 ms  te-0-8-0-2-ar01.woburn.ma.boston.comcast.net [68.85.162.93]

  5    14 ms     9 ms     9 ms  pos-0-15-0-0-ar01.needham.ma.boston.comcast.net [68.85.162.145]

  6    15 ms    14 ms    22 ms  pos-0-0-0-0-ar01.chartford.ct.hartford.comcast.net [68.85.162.70]

  7    16 ms    18 ms    17 ms  pos-2-4-0-0-cr01.newyork.ny.ibone.comcast.net [68.86.90.61]

  8    22 ms    18 ms    17 ms  Vlan546.icore1.NJY-Newark.as6453.net [206.82.132.41]

  9    17 ms    45 ms    18 ms  if-6-0-0-25.mcore3.NJY-Newark.as6453.net [216.6.57.41]

 10    19 ms    17 ms    18 ms  if-2-0.core1.NTO-NewYork.as6453.net [216.6.57.66]

 11    17 ms    18 ms    19 ms  sl-gw31-nyc-14-0-0.sprintlink.net [160.81.249.29]

 12    18 ms    19 ms    17 ms  sl-crs2-nyc-0-2-0-0.sprintlink.net [144.232.13.35]

 13    23 ms    27 ms    19 ms  sl-bb20-msq-2-0-0.sprintlink.net [144.232.20.74]

 14    22 ms    22 ms    24 ms  sl-bb21-msq-15-0-0.sprintlink.net [144.232.9.110]

 15    26 ms    26 ms    27 ms  sl-crs1-rly-0-8-5-0.sprintlink.net [144.232.20.73]

 16    25 ms    25 ms    26 ms  sl-bb20-dc-5-0-0.sprintlink.net [144.232.8.162]

 17    24 ms    28 ms    25 ms  sl-crs1-dc-0-0-0-0.sprintlink.net [144.232.15.11]

 18    74 ms    73 ms    74 ms  sl-crs2-fw-0-11-3-0.sprintlink.net [144.232.19.200]

 19     *        *        *     Request timed out.

 20     *        *        *     Request timed out.

 21     *        *        *     Request timed out.

 22     *        *        *     Request timed out.

 23     *        *        *     Request timed out.

 24     *        *        *     Request timed out.

 25     *        *        *     Request timed out.

 26     *        *        *     Request timed out.

 27     *        *        *     Request timed out.

 28     *        *        *     Request timed out.

 29     *        *        *     Request timed out.

 30     *        *        *     Request timed out.

 

Trace complete.

As you can see, the communication makes it to "sl-crs2-fw-0-11-3-0.sprintlink.net [144.232.19.200]" and then fails.  Sprintlink.net is inside of the Sprint network.  To get as far as I did required the services of three companies, Comcast (comcast.net),  Tata Communications (as6453.net), and Sprint (sprintlink.net). None of these companies is my company (sagewoodstudios.com) or my photolab service provider (exposuremanager.com).  In fact after the last hop, I don't know what the next address would be--it might be a fourth company, or another server in the Sprint network.  Exposure Manager can't help me--it's not their computer.  Comcast can't help me--it's not their computer either.  Sprint *might* be able to help me, but I'm not their customer. 

What I do know is, if I didn't have to use this route, I would indeed be able to get there.  I found an online provider of the standard 'net tools (ping, traceroute, etc.) called Network-Tools.com (that's a handy link btw, you might want to bookmark it).  I can get to their server to see their website, and when I ask THEM to do a traceroute to exposuremanager, they can get there just fine:

TraceRoute to 66.254.91.235 [exposuremanager.com]

Hop

(ms)

(ms)

(ms)

IP Address

Host name

1

8

6

6

206.123.69.137

-

2

9

6

6

8.9.232.73

xe-5-3-0.edge3.dallas1.level3.net

3

12

7

7

4.69.145.140

ae-3-80.edge2.dallas3.level3.net

4

8

15

6

4.71.220.14

xo-communic.edge2.dallas3.level3.net

5

10

12

9

207.88.13.122

207.88.13.122.ptr.us.xo.net

6

41

40

40

207.88.12.46

207.88.12.46.ptr.us.xo.net

7

41

40

40

65.106.1.69

65.106.1.69.ptr.us.xo.net

8

41

49

52

65.106.5.10

p0-0-0.mar2.la-ca.us.xo.net

9

46

40

40

207.88.81.170

p15-0.chr1.la-ca.us.xo.net

10

50

44

45

66.238.50.106

66.238.50.106.ptr.us.xo.net

11

53

45

47

66.254.64.1

gw1.pixelgate.net

12

53

50

47

66.254.91.235

host235.exposuremanager.com

Trace complete

As you can see, because they are starting from a different provider (level3.net) their communication path takes a different route that never involves any of the companies I'm forced to use.  If Network-Tools.com provided a "browser in a browser" basically an embedded frame that I could point anywhere I want to, I'd be able to get to my photolab and process my customer's orders.

In the meantime I'm pretty stuck.  I can't help my customers, and my service provider can't help me.  Welcome to the Internet... where you really "can't get thar from hyar".